Top 10 Features of an Effective Taxi Dispatch System An effective taxi dispatch system can transform how a taxi service operates, bringing efficiency, reliability, and superior customer satisfaction. With the rapid advancements in technology, modern dispatch systems are packed with features designed to streamline operations and enhance the overall service quality. Here are the top 10 features that make a taxi dispatch system truly effective. 1. Real-Time GPS Tracking Real-time GPS tracking is essential for modern taxi dispatch systems. It allows dispatchers to see the exact location of each vehicle, enabling them to assign the nearest available taxi to a customer. This reduces wait times and ensures quicker service. Additionally, GPS tracking helps monitor driver routes and performance, ensuring that drivers are taking the most efficient paths. 2. Automated Dispatching Automated dispatching uses advanced algorithms to assign the best-suited driver to a ride request automatically. This feature eliminates the need for manual intervention, reducing errors and speeding up the dispatch process. It ensures that customers are matched with the closest available taxi, improving efficiency and customer satisfaction. 3. Mobile App Integration
Integration with a mobile app is crucial in today’s smartphone-driven world. A dedicated passenger app allows customers to book rides, track their taxi in real-time, and receive notifications about their ride status. Similarly, a driver app helps drivers manage their bookings, navigate routes, and communicate with dispatchers seamlessly. 4. In-App Payment Processing Offering in-app payment options enhances convenience for both customers and drivers. Customers can pay for their rides through the app using various payment methods like credit/debit cards, digital wallets, or other online payment systems. This feature ensures secure and hassle-free transactions, eliminating the need for cash handling. 5. Driver Management A comprehensive driver management feature helps in maintaining driver profiles, tracking their performance, and managing their schedules. It includes tools for monitoring driver behavior, such as speeding, harsh braking, and idling, ensuring that drivers adhere to safety standards. Effective driver management leads to better service quality and customer safety. 6. Customer Management Effective taxi dispatch systems also include customer management features. This allows for maintaining detailed customer profiles, including their ride history, preferences, and feedback. Having this information helps in providing personalized services, improving customer loyalty, and addressing any issues promptly. 7. Route Optimization Route optimization ensures that drivers take the most efficient routes to reach their destinations. This feature takes into account real-time traffic conditions, road closures, and other factors that can affect travel time. By optimizing routes, dispatch systems help reduce fuel consumption, lower operational costs, and provide quicker service. 8. Automated Fare Calculation Accurate fare calculation is vital for building trust with customers. An effective dispatch system calculates fares automatically based on distance traveled, time, and other factors like surge pricing during peak hours. This transparency ensures that customers are charged fairly and consistently. 9. Analytics and Reporting Analytics and reporting tools provide valuable insights into the taxi service’s operations. These tools can generate reports on various metrics, such as trip durations, driver performance,
revenue, and customer feedback. By analyzing this data, taxi companies can identify areas for improvement, optimize their operations, and make informed business decisions. 10. Customer Support Integration Integrating customer support within the dispatch system ensures that any issues or concerns are addressed promptly. Features like in-app chat, call support, and feedback forms allow customers to communicate their problems directly. Quick resolution of issues leads to higher customer satisfaction and loyalty.
